Buscar

SD - Atividade para avaliação - Semana 4

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es
Você viu 3, do total de 4 páginas

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Prévia do material em texto

1.6 ptsPergunta 1
No servidor existe o stub do servidor, que é responsável por enviar um pacote de informações remotas.
O funcionamento de uma RPC (Remote Procedure Call) utliza somente stubs no cliente.
Para o núcleo do SO, apenas o envio de mensagens é transparente, ou seja, ele não sabe que é um RPC.
O funcionamento de uma RPC (Remote Procedure Call) utliza somente stubs no servidor.
Dentre os problemas oriundos da comunicação entre duas aplicações distribuídas, destacam-se: os espaços de endereços
diferentes, problemas no cliente e servidor e arquiteturas diferentes (o que interfere nos tipos de dados).
“O modelo cliente-servidor apresenta alguns problemas como a propagação de erros em um sistema
distribuído, é baseado em E/S, parece ser um sistema centralizado, entre outros". Julgue a afirmação
a seguir, considerando a utilização de chamadas remotas de procedimentos, que são importantes
para garantir a transparência na comunicação entre duas aplicações distribuídas.
1.6 ptsPergunta 2
Apenas as afirmativas I, II e IV estão corretas.
Apenas as afirmativas I, III e IV estão corretas.
Apenas as afirmativas I e III estão corretas.
Apenas as afirmativas II e III estão corretas.
Apenas as afirmativas III e IV estão corretas.
Em relação as chamadas remotas de procedimentos, julgue as afirmações a seguir:
Em RPC, é comum o uso de linguagem de descrição de interface (Interface Description
Language – IDL), que garante interoperabilidade em várias plataformas.
I.
O RPC não é imune a falhas quando observado em uma perspectiva de comunicação em
uma rede de dados.
II.
Em RPC, o procedimento de chamada precisa estar na mesma estação do procedimento de
resposta.
III.
A independência do transporte do RPC isola a aplicação de elementos lógicos e físicos em
um sistema.
IV.
Assinale a alternativa correta:
1.6 ptsPergunta 3
Apenas a afirmativa II está correta.
Apenas a afirmativa I está correta.
Apenas as afirmativas II, III e IV estão corretas.
Apenas as afirmativas I, II e IV estão corretas.
Todas as afirmativas estão corretas.
No modelo de fila de mensagens, a comunicação é persistente e assíncrona com desacoplamento
temporal. Acerca desse modelo, julgue as afirmações a seguir:
As mensagens ficam armazenadas até que o receptor possa consumi-las.I.
A interface básica para esse modelo possui métodos como GET, PUT, POLL e Notify.II.
Na arquitetura desse tipo de sistema de fila de mensagens, cada fila possui um identificador
único em todo o sistema distribuído e cada máquina oferece uma interface para o envio e
recepção de mensagens.
III.
Clientes podem estar ligados a um ou mais servidores responsáveis pelo encaminhamento de
mensagens (roteamento).
IV.
Agora responda:
1.6 ptsPergunta 4
O objetivo do FEC (Forward Error Correction) é rearranjar a sequência dos pacotes no receptor antes da transmissão, uma
vez que o áudio pode ser enviado intercalado, e, assim, se garante que não haja variação de atraso.
Na transmissão de voz, seja ela feita via TCP ou UDP, cada datagrama recebe uma marcação e, após o envio do primeiro
pacote, a variação de atraso é sempre zero.
É uma variação estatística do atraso na entrega de dados em uma rede, ou seja, pode ser definida como a medida de
variação do atraso entre os pacotes sucessivos de dados.
Na estratégia atraso fixo, o receptor tenta reproduzir cada parte exatamente em alguns milissegundos após a parte ter sido
gerada, sendo essa uma estratégia para atenuar os efeitos da variação de atraso na transmissão da voz.
A bufferização é utilizada para reduzir o atraso tanto no emissor quanto no receptor.
A correção direta de erros ou a codificação de canais é uma técnica usada para controlar erros na
transmissão de dados por canais de comunicação não confiáveis ou ruidosos. Acerca da FEC, é
correto dizer que:
1.6 ptsPergunta 5
Acerca da QoS (Qualidade de Serviço), julgue as assertivas a seguir:
Apenas a assertiva IV está correta.
Apenas a assertiva II está correta.
Apenas as assertivas II e IV estão corretas.
Apenas as assertivas I e III estão corretas.
Apenas as assertivas II e III estão corretas.
Quando o buffer de um roteador está cheio, o protocolo DiffServ realiza classificação
automática de pacotes a serem descartados.
I.
Em uma rede com tráfego conhecido, é possível dispor mais recursos em tempos
determinados e manter qualidade nos serviços.
II.
Um erro que não pode ser medido em métricas de QoS é a perda de pacotes, já que não é
possível que os roteadores estimem a quantidade de pacotes reenviados.
III.
Atrasos em uma rede é o menor fator de impacto na qualidade de um serviço de tempo real.IV.
Agora responda:
2 ptsPergunta 6
Assinale verdadeiro ou falso para as afirmativas a seguir:
VERDADEIRO Embora RPC contribua para esconder a comunicação nos sistemas distribuídos
(transparência), assume-se que ambas as partes (cliente e servidor) estejam ativas no mesmo
instante para permitir a comunicação.
VERDADEIRO A QoS (Qualidade de Serviços) trata de diversos requisitos para garantir que as
relações em um fluxo de dados possam ser preservadas. Em geral essa qualidade é garantida por
contratos denominados SLA (Service Level Agreements) em que podem constar atributos como:
atraso, variação do atraso e link de comunicação.
VERDADEIRO Uma das vantagens da RPC é garantir o funcionamento da comunicação passando
informações em espaços de endereçamento distintos, ainda considerando a queda dos hosts que se
comunicam e também que a arquitetura de ambos seja diferente.
VERDADEIRO Os protocolos de comunicação formam a base para qualquer sistema distribuído,
cuja característica é funcionar sem memória compartilhada e com a comunicação baseada na troca
de mensagens.
VERDADEIRO RPC (Remote Procedure Call) é um paradigma de programação de fácil uso, que
segue o modelo cliente/servidor com as vantagens de sistemas distribuídos, tais como
balanceamento, disponibilidade por replicação e ocultamento de complexidades da rede.
Salvo em 11:06 Enviar teste

Outros materiais